TL;DR Summary

Bishop Joseph Strickland of Tyler, Texas, has become a prominent figure in the traditionalist wing of American Catholicism, openly criticizing Pope Francis and the Vatican for what he sees as a dilution of core teachings. The Vatican has investigated Bishop Strickland's leadership and is reportedly considering asking for his resignation, but the bishop has publicly refused to resign. This clash poses a delicate challenge for the Vatican, given Bishop Strickland's popularity among conservative Catholics. Many see him as standing up for their values in the face of a liberal Catholic hierarchy. The conflict comes as the Vatican hosts a landmark global gathering, the Synod on Synodality, which has alarmed conservatives who fear it could result in changes to church teachings on issues like women's ordination and same-sex unions.
